What style resonates with you the most?Types of Metal Legs to ConsiderThere are various styles of metal legs, including hairpin, pedestal, and trestle designs. Hairpin legs are trendy and minimalist, while pedestal legs provide stability and a modern look. Which style do you think would best fit your dining room?Consider the finish of the metal as well. Matte finishes can create a softer look, while shiny finishes add a touch of elegance. How do you envision the finish complementing your wooden tabletop?Tips for Blending Metal Legs with Wooden TablesTo achieve a harmonious look, consider the color and texture of your wood. Darker woods typically pair well with black or dark metal finishes, while lighter woods often complement brushed or chrome finishes. What other elements are you thinking of incorporating?FAQQ: What is the best way to clean metal dining table legs?A: Use a soft cloth with mild soap and water to wipe down metal legs. Avoid abrasive cleaners that could scratch the surface.Q: Can I use metal legs with any type of wood table?A: Yes, metal legs can complement various wood types, but consider the color and style to ensure a cohesive look.Q: Are metal legs durable for heavy wooden tables?A: Absolutely!
